The phrase pet groomers Fayetteville covers a variety of solutions and abilities. A typical consultation can include a bathroom with a coat-appropriate hair shampoo, blow dry, full brush out, nail trim and data, ear cleansing, sanitary trim, and a hairstyle if the breed calls for it. Many salons in the location additionally provide de-shedding for heavy layers, gland expression upon request, flea and tick bathrooms, medicated shampoos, paw balm, and coat conditioning. For cats, solutions are customized to decrease anxiety, and usually consist of baths, comb-outs, hygienic trims, stubborn belly cuts, and lion cuts for those who mat easily.
An excellent groomer is part stylist, component trainer, and component wellness screener. I have actually flagged ear infections on Cocker Spaniels, caught yeast issues between a bully breed's toes, and found a questionable swelling under a Golden Retriever's armpit. The catch is that groomers are not vets, yet they are frequently the first to observe changes due to the fact that they see and feel every square inch of a pet's skin and layer on a normal cadence. Pricing is not one dimension fits all. It depends upon dimension, coat kind, problem, and habits. In our market, small dog full bridegrooms frequently vary from 60 to 85 bucks, medium from 75 to 110, and large or extra large can run 95 to 160 or even more, especially for heavy-coated types needing de-shedding. Bath and neat solutions are generally 15 to 30 bucks less than full grooms. Nail trims as a walk-in solution typically run 12 to 20 bucks, nail grinding 5 to 10 bucks more. Pet cat pet grooming is much more specialized and commonly begins around 85 bucks for a bath and comb-out, with lion cuts frequently in the 100 to 140 variety depending upon coat problem and handling time. If a groomer needs a second trainer, a muzzle for safety, or extra de-matting time, expect add-on costs in 10 to 30 dollar increments.
These arrays mirror what diligent animal groomers in Fayetteville, NC normally charge. If you see rates far below that, ask what is included and how much time is allotted per pet. A hurried groom can suggest shortcuts that your pet dog really feels later, from scissoring on a moving table to a blower set hotter than it must be.

Short-coated breeds like Beagles, Martial Artists, and Staffordshire mixes do not obtain clipper cuts, but take advantage of routine baths, coat de-shedding rubs with rubber curry brushes, same-day grooming available and extensive drying out that raises dead hair. With these pets, it is simple to take too lightly shedding quantity. In my experience, a 25 minute burn out every 4 to 6 weeks can cut tumbleweeds in the house by half.
Double-coated types, usual in our area, from Huskies to German Shepherds, impact layer seasonally and additionally on a loosened 3 to 4 month cycle. A healthy de-shed bath makes use of a coat-specific hair shampoo, a conditioner to launch undercoat, and a sequence of high rate drying out and line brushing. Stay clear of cutting these types to the skin. It can harm layer texture, increase sunburn threat, and affect how the coat protects. A clean with plume neatening and sanitary work maintains them comfy without compromising layer function.
Poodle and doodle layers require rhythm. If you prefer a cosy teddy trim, your friend is frequency. Every 4 to 6 weeks with at-home brushing every other day keeps the layer from felting at the armpits, behind the ears, and in the groin. If you wish to extend to 8 to 10 weeks, speak with your groomer concerning a shorter, functional length that can hold up. A 1 inch deluxe appearance lasts if the coat is continually detangled, but matted coats require a reset to a brief clip for the pet's comfort and safety.
Terriers and cord layers take advantage of either clippering or hand stripping. Real hand removing preserves shade and texture, however it requires time and skill. In Fayetteville, some groomers provide a hybrid strategy, hand removing the back and furnishings while clippering sensitive areas. If a breed basic matters to you, ask particularly regarding removing experience and routine much longer appointments.
Seniors or pet dogs with health problems need alterations. Lower heat drying out, short breaks off the table, non-slip mats, mild dematting tools, and occasionally a two-visit strategy lower fatigue. I have actually divided a groom for a 14 year old Shih Tzu right into bath and nails on day one, hairstyle on day 2, at the owner's request. A great beauty parlor will certainly suit within reason.
Cats reviewed the space. A hair salon that deals with pet cats on set days or throughout quiet hours decreases tension. Ask whether they work on a feline-only block or different cats from canines in a different space. For solutions, many pet cats succeed with a bathroom and thorough comb-out every 8 to 12 weeks if they are long-haired. Maine Coons and Persians matt along the spinal column, behind the forelegs, and near the tail base. Mats are not cosmetic. They draw skin, conceal particles, and can trap wetness that results in sores.
Lion cuts have their duty when a coat is showered or the pet cat is older and can not brush appropriately. The key is secure handling. A certain feline groomer clips with protected blades, maintains sessions efficient, and looks for warmth anxiety. Several will not provide anal gland expression for cats, which is practical, and will stay clear of tweezing ear hair unless a veterinarian prescribes it. For fractious felines, some salons will certainly refer to a veterinary facility that can calm safely. That is not a failing. It is liable risk management.
You can not enjoy the entire bridegroom, however you can identify signs of a well-run shop. Tables and bathtubs should be sturdy with working restrictions that safeguard a pet dog without choking. Dryer hoses have to be tidy, filters transformed usually, and warm setups traditional. Cage clothes dryers are questionable for a factor. They can be safe when made use of on ambient or reduced heat with direct guidance and timers, but they need to never replacement for hands-on drying out in brachycephalic breeds like Bulldogs or Pugs.
Good beauty parlors likewise log occurrences. If a clipper melt takes place on a poodle foot because an animal kicked at the incorrect moment, it obtains recorded, proprietors are notified at pick-up, after-care is described, and the following appointment changes strategy. Accidents are uncommon in careful hands, but no openness is a red flag.
Mobile pet grooming has grown in Fayetteville because it fixes two troubles. It lowers time in a kennel for anxious pets and removes the drive across town. The experience is one-to-one, typically 60 to 120 mins per pet dog, and the van parks in your driveway. The compromise is price and reserving adaptability. Mobile solution normally sets you back 20 to 40 percent more than an equivalent beauty salon bridegroom, and paths fill early. Houses with restricted vehicle parking or gated communities can complicate gain access to. If your dog barks at every truck in the cul-de-sac, the novelty of a van humming outside the front door might be an and also or a minus, so take into consideration temperament.
Brick and mortar beauty parlors deal with bigger dogs more easily, use even more appointment ports, and can staff several groomers, which assists when you have 2 or 3 pets to coordinate. They often run packages for bath-only brows through in between complete bridegrooms. If you prepare a lengthy day on Ft Liberty or a commute to Raleigh, a beauty parlor with very early drop-off and afternoon pick-up aligned to your hours deserves gold.

Anxiety shows up as shivering, yawning, lip licking, or outright refusal to step through the door. For canines brand-new to grooming or saves with uneven history, choreograph the very first visit. Walk once around the structure, let the pet dog sniff, and keep your energy calmness. Inside, a brief meet-and-greet adhered to by a nail trim or a bathroom just is kinder than a marathon. Some beauty salons allow you to bring a preferred floor covering or tee shirt that smells like home for the kennel. Skip heavy meals right prior to the consultation to prevent queasiness in the bathtub. If your pet dog rises under the dryer, an excellent groomer will switch over to a towel and lower air flow, or schedule a two-part drying session.
Desensitization in the house settles. Mimic clipper noise with an electrical tooth brush near the pet dog, deal with paws for seconds daily, and reward. I have turned screamers into stoics over three sees by matching short, very easy wins with client handling. It is not magic. It is repetition.
Brushing is less costly than dematting. Utilize a slicker brush and a stainless steel comb. The brush raises hair, the comb discovers tangles the brush skates over. Focus on friction areas: behind ears, armpits, collar line, tail base, and where legs meet the body. For double-coated types, a regular 10 minute undercoat rake session adhered to by a quick brush decreases dropping and keeps skin healthy. Keep nails trimmed every 3 to 4 weeks. Long nails alter gait, stress joints, and make grooming even more difficult since quicks grow with the nail.
Bathing at home is great if you rinse extensively. Remaining shampoo creates itch. Dry totally to the skin, particularly on undercoated breeds and longhairs. Wet undercoat can mildew, and moist floor coverings tighten up as they dry out. If you do not have a high velocity clothes dryer, blot with towels, brush while drying out on a reduced, cool setup, and strategy added time.
Spring and fall bring layer impacts. Anticipate much heavier dropping and longer de-shed sessions. Summertime warmth says for shorter trims on decrease coats like Shih Tzus and Yorkies, but shaved to the skin is seldom the solution beyond extreme matting. For dual layers, maintain the all-natural defense and concentrate on air movement with a good brush out. Ticks and fleas spike in cozy months, so maintain preventives existing and inform your groomer if you have actually seen insects. The majority of beauty parlors need treatment prior to a groom if live fleas are present, or they will certainly add a flea bathroom and quarantine to maintain the salon clean.
Winter dry skin can trigger dandruff. A gentle oat meal or hypoallergenic hair shampoo coupled with a conditioner aids. If a pet is itchy post-groom, ask the hair salon what items were made use of and take into consideration patch screening a sensitive-skin formula following time.
A groomer who keeps notes does you a support. Layer length last time, blade and comb used, ear standing, matting locations, habits information, and items used develop uniformity. If a poodle looked best at a 5 comb body with teddy head and tight feet, you will obtain that once again, even if a different stylist manages your consultation. If your feline endured a bath ideal initially, after that a short break, that obtains repeated. Ask exactly how the beauty salon tracks and shares these information. Some will message a short summary. Others will assess at pick-up and compose on a client card.

The ideal results come from tempo and interaction. When a groomer sees your dog every 4 to 8 weeks, they discover ear patterns, layer quirks, and exactly how to time restroom breaks to prevent accidents in the bathtub. They are most likely to find a new lump at half an inch instead of an inch. You additionally get top priority organizing. A lot of developed hair salons in Fayetteville pre-book customers out two or 3 appointments. If you call the week prior to a vacation wishing for a full groom Saturday at 10 a.m., a regular place on the books is your finest shot.
Regulars gain from truthful conversations too. I have actually told proprietors when a 12 week period is also long for their dog's coat and suggested 6 weeks with a somewhat longer trim to maintain the appearance they prefer. That compromise costs a bit more each year, yet it stays clear of the cycle of matting and shave downs, which pets do not like and owners regret.

Red flags in dog grooming include unsanitary tools, aggressive handling of dogs, lack of proper certification, and signs of neglect or stress in pets. Long waiting times, hidden fees, or unclear service policies can also indicate issues. Communication and transparency are key. Observing the environment and staff behavior helps identify reliable groomers.

Grooming a dog can take 4 hours due to factors such as coat length, matting, breed-specific cuts, and the dog’s behavior. Bathing, drying, brushing, nail trimming, and styling all take time. Stressed or anxious dogs may require additional handling to ensure safety. Complex or specialty cuts significantly extend grooming duration.
The frequency of grooming depends on breed, coat type, and lifestyle. Short-haired dogs may only need grooming every 6–8 weeks, while long-haired or high-maintenance breeds often require grooming every 4–6 weeks. Regular brushing between sessions helps prevent matting. Professional grooming ensures coat health, cleanliness, and nail care.
The hardest dogs to groom are usually long-haired, double-coated, or high-maintenance breeds such as Afghan Hounds, Shih Tzus, and Samoyeds. Thick mats, sensitive skin, and active behavior increase grooming difficulty. Groomers may need specialized tools and techniques. Anxiety or aggression in some dogs can also make the process challenging.
Dogs can typically go 6–12 weeks without professional grooming, depending on breed and coat type. Long-haired or fast-growing breeds may develop mats, tangles, and skin issues sooner. Regular brushing at home can extend the interval between professional grooming. Neglecting grooming for too long can lead to discomfort or health problems.
